SEPTEMBER IS KINSHIP AWARENESS MONTH

Kinship Care is recognized as the full-time protection and nurture of children by relatives, member of their Tribes or clans, godparents, stepparents, fictive kin or non-related extended family members.  The definition is inclusive and respectful of cultural values an ties of affection.  Whether formally through child protective services of informally through family arrangements, kinship care aims to reduce the trauma of family separation and provide cultural and community ties.

Whether informally arranged among family members or formally supported by the child welfare system, it is essential to affirm and support the considerable contributions of kinship caregivers.
